MCEM Diagnostics
Pinpoints the functional MCEM stage by reading CRM entity state and validates exit criteria against Verifiable Outcomes — all in one pass.
Freedom Level
Medium — VO interpretation requires judgment; exit-criteria checks are rule-based.
Modes
| Mode | Trigger Keywords | Purpose |
|---|
| Identify | which stage, what stage, stage mismatch, diagnose | Determine functional vs. declared stage |
| Validate | exit criteria, are we ready, VO audit, ready to advance | Check criteria for progression |
Both modes run by default. If user only asks "which stage" without mentioning exit criteria, identify mode can run standalone.
Flow
- Call
msx:crm_get_record on opportunity for stage, solution play, success plan, activestageid.
- Call
msx:get_milestones with opportunityId for milestone state.
- Stage identification — compare CRM artifacts against MCEM exit criteria:
| Transition | Evidence Required |
|---|
| Stage 1 → 2 | Qualified opportunity exists + solution play selected |
| Stage 2 → 3 | CSP created + business value reviewed + plays confirmed |
| Stage 3 → 4 | Customer agreement + resources aligned (msp_commitmentrecommendation = 861980003) |
| Stage 4 → 5 | Solution delivered (msp_milestonestatus = 861980003) + health metrics agreed |
- Non-linear rule: If CRM Stage says "Stage 3" but no CSP or Business Value Assessment found → label as Functional Stage 2 (At Risk).
- Exit criteria validation — for the current/target stage gate, map achieved VOs:
| Gate | Criterion | CRM Evidence |
|---|
| 1→2 | Qualified opportunity | opportunity.statecode = 0 + activestageid past qualification |
| 1→2 | Solution play selected | opportunity.msp_salesplay ne null |
| 2→3 | Plays confirmed | opportunity.msp_salesplay valid value |
| 2→3 | Business value reviewed | BVA entity status = Complete |
| 2→3 | CSP created | msp_successplan linked |
| 3→4 | Customer agreement | opportunity.activestageid post-commitment |
| 3→4 | Resources aligned | msp_commitmentrecommendation = 861980003 + msp_milestonedate set |
| 4→5 | Solution delivered | msp_milestonestatus = 861980003 |
| 4→5 | Health metrics agreed | CSP health fields populated |
- Report pass/fail per criterion. Flag BPF stage divergence from VO-based stage.
Decision Logic
- All criteria met → stage progression supported, recommend next-stage skills
- Partial → list specific gaps with remediation actions and accountable role
- BPF vs. functional divergence → flag discrepancy explicitly as highest-priority finding
- Route gaps to the accountable role for the current stage (ATU→STU→CSU per MCEM model)
Output Schema
current_crm_stage: stage reflected in MSX/D365
functional_mcem_stage: stage supported by verifiable outcomes
outcome_gaps: numbered list of missing exit criteria
criteria_results: pass/fail per criterion with CRM evidence (validate mode)
overall_readiness: ready | not_ready | partial
bpf_vs_vo_discrepancy: flag if declared stage differs from evidence-based stage
recommended_lead: which role should lead next steps based on functional stage
next_action: names the appropriate skill for gap remediation or next-stage entry
